  • This study aims to help understanding on design of basic pattern of shirt collars and to suggest schemes to raise completeness of shape by reviewing problems shown in finished products after sewing. From March 2009 to August 2009, 12 patterns for education and firms were collected centering on basic shirt collar form respectively. There are four problems generally raised from a completed shirt collar. In case of overlapping shirt collar on front neck point, the sewing point of shirt collar should be drawn at front neck point of collar band at a distance of about 0.2~0.3cm, and the center front of band and one of bodice should be arranged in a straight line. In case of the problem about right and left length difference of shirt collar, it is raised by closing so the problem was solved by prolonging about 0.2 cm of the center front of left collar. It was evaluated that adjusting notch point when sewing would be more rational solution than solving something on patterns for distance difference problem of shirt collar between right and left part at center front. And a problem about getting loose of front garment between collar band below and the first button was also raised. It was designed 0.2cm cut of collar band. Around basic shirt collar form, above mentioned solutions are applied to the patterns for education and manufacture experimental clothing. So as a result of sensory evaluation, generally good ratings on all items were received.

  • In this paper we introduce and consider a new class of variational inequalities with four operators. This class is called the extended general mixed quasi variational inequality. We show that the extended general mixed quasi variational inequality is equivalent to the fixed point problem. We use this alternative equivalent formulation to discuss the existence of a solution of extended general mixed quasi variational inequality and also develop several iterative methods for solving extended general mixed quasi variational inequality and its variant forms. We consider the convergence analysis of the proposed iterative methods under appropriate conditions. We also introduce a new class of resolvent equation, which is called the extended general implicit resolvent equation and establish an equivalent relation between the extended general implicit resolvent equation and the extended general mixed quasi variational inequality. Some special cases are also discussed.

  • This article investigates various transcription techniques for the Legendre pseudospectral (PS) method to compare the pros and cons of each approach. Eight combinations from four different types of collocation points and two discretization methods for dynamic constraints, which differentiate Legendre PS transcription techniques, are implemented to solve a carefully selected test set of nonlinear optimal control problems (NOCPs). The convergence property and prediction accuracy are compared to provide a useful guideline for selecting the best combination. The tested NOCPs consist of the minimum time, minimum energy, and problems with state and control constraints. Therefore, the results drawn from this comparative study apply to the solution of similar types of NOCPs and can mitigate much debate about the best combinations. Additionally, important findings from this study can be used to improve the numerical efficiency of the Legendre PS methods. Three PS applications to the aerospace engineering problems are demonstrated to prove this point.

  • A novel three-phase four-wire inverter topology is presented in this paper. This topology is equipped with a special capacitor balance grid without magnetic saturation. In response to unbalanced load and unequal split DC-link capacitors problems, a qusi-full-bridge DC/DC topology is applied in the balance grid. By using a high-frequency transformer, the energy transfer within the two split dc-link capacitors is realized. The novel topology makes the voltage across two split dc-link capacitors balanced so that the neutral point voltage ripple is inhibited. Under the condition of a stable neutral point voltage, the three-phase four-wire inverter can be equivalent to three independent single phase inverters. As a result, the three-phase inverter can produce symmetrical voltage waves with an unbalanced load. To avoid forward transformer magnetic saturation, the voltages of the primary and secondary windings are controlled to reverse once during each switching period. Furthermore, an improved mode chosen operating principle for this novel topology is designed and analyzed in detail. The simulated results verified the feasibility of this topology and an experimental inverter has been built to test the power quality produced by this topology. Finally, simulation results verify that the novel topology can effectively improve the inhibition of an inverter with a three-phase unbalanced load while decreasing the value of the split capacitor.

  • Small area model provides reliable and accurate estimations when the sample size is not sufficient. Our dataset has an inherent nonlinear pattern which signicantly affects our inference. In this case, we could consider semiparametric models such as truncated polynomial basis function and radial basis function. In this paper, we study four Bayesian semiparametric models for small areas to handle this point. Four small area models are based on two kinds of basis function and different knots positions. To evaluate the different estimates, four comparison measurements have been employed as criteria. In these comparison measurements, the truncated polynomial basis function with equal quantile knots has shown the best result. In Bayesian calculation, we use Gibbs sampler to solve the numerical problems.

  • Purpose: The study aimed to examine the influence of PNF direct and indirect breathing treatments for patients with cervical spinal cord injuries who had breathing problems. Methods: For each cervical spinal cord patient, force vital capacity (FVC), peak expiratory flow, maximum phonation time (MPT), rib cage width, and VAS were measured pre-intervention and four weeks after post-intervention. The indirect method and the direct method were used for interventions. We treated patients with the indirect method using scapular anterior depression pattern, bilateral extensor pattern with rhythmic initiation, and a combination of isotonic. We treated patients with the direct method, applying pressure on the sternum and using rhythmic initiation (hold relax and stretch reflex) for the rib cage. Training occurred for 50 minutes a day and three days per week for four weeks. Results: FVC, MPT, peak expiratory flow, and rib cage width were increased and decreased at the VAS point for rolling after treatment. Conclusion: Patients with cervical spinal cord injuries who had breathing problems felt uncomfortable when they had conversations on a couch. We found that PNF direct and indirect treatments improved rib cage width and breathing functions of patients with cervical spinal cord injuries.

  • This study makes clear Huang Yuan-Yu(黃元御)'s medical thoughts Yi-philosophically. Yi-philosophy(易學) since ancient times is occupied by fundamental problems of various fields of Oriental Science. Confusian Medicine Reseachers of Zhang Jie-Bin(張介賓), Zhang Nan(章楠), Zhu Zhen-Heng(朱震亨) was seriously affected by Yi-philosophy(易學) and Confucianism(儒學). But I don't think that the majority of their medicine theories are occupied by Yi-philosophy(易學) and Confucianism(儒學). But Huang Yuan-Yu(黃元御) studied medicine thoughts on the basis of Tu Shu Yi(圖書易) in almost whole medicine theories and clinical contents. Therefore this study researched medical thinkings of Huang Yuan-Yu(黃元御) on Yi-philosophical medical viewpoint Tu Shu Yi(圖書易)-scientifically. Especially in this paper the author examined a characteristic point in medical thoughts of Huang Yuan-Yu(黃元御), the difference of existing medicine on Nei-Jing(內經) and Yi-medicine of Huang Yuan-Yu(黃元御), a commonness of medicine principles of Huang Yuan-Yu(黃元御) and Li Ji-Ma(李濟馬)), medicine theories of Huang Yuan-Yu(黃元御) on Tu Shu Yi(圖書易) and a background of Yi-philosophical medical standpoint. The results was summarized as follows; First, Huang Yuan-Yu(黃元御)'s standpoint on five phase is that the relation of earth and wood fire metal water is form and use(體用). Huang Yuan-Yu(黃元御) insists that the earth represents existence itself and wood fire metal water is concepts that represents actual states. Second, the concept of Four-Constitution of Huang Yuan-Yu(黃元御) and Li Ji-Ma(李濟馬) is same. Third, Huang Yuan-Yu(黃元御) doesn't have a standpoint of five-phase on Nei-Ching Medicine, but a standpoint of five-phase on Yi-philosophy. Fourth, water, fire, metal, wood is Four-Constitution that middle qi transformed. Fifth, the middle qi is yang-earth and yin-earth of the spleen and stomach, the physiological function of four viscera is maintained by the movement of ascending and descending of yin and yang earth. Sixth, The middle qi is main role of Four-Constitution. Exchanging of water and fire and the movement of ascending and descending of metal and wood depends on the earth. Seventh, generally medicine researchers speak that human mind is a main role of psycho-function of heart, but Huang Yuan-Yu has the standpoint of spleen-stomach oriented seven emotions not human-mind oriented viewpoint. It represents that a existing thinking of heart-earth center is changed to medical viewpoint of spleen-earth center. Eighth, There is enough ground for controversy on where is the middle point of human in five viscera. Is that spleen or heart? Huang Yuan-Yu(黃元御) insists that the spleen and stomach is middle point, but the standpoint in Four-Constitution medicine of Li Ji-Ma(李濟馬) is that middle point is heart.

  • To investigate the risk perception of environmental issues, two consequtive surveys were conducted to environmental professionals using a standardized questionnaire from September to October in 1999. The number of subjects were 72 for the first survey and 68 for the second one. The questionnaire was consisted of items such as the degree of environmental pollution in Korea, risk perception of some issues on human health and ecosystem, and seriousness of the problems in the real situation in Korea. For the degree of environmental pollution in Korea, the average risk rating in the second test (7.4 point) was significantly higher than that in the first test (7.2 point). The risk perception on the general human health and ecosystem, and the seriousness in Korea situation were analyzed in the order of ′air pollution′, ′water pollution′,′soil contamination′,′waste′,′toxic chemical pollutants′,′food contamination′,′ocean contamination′, ′odor pollution′, and ′noise pollution′. Also ′toxic chemical pollutants′ problem was perceived to be the highest risk on general human health or ecosystem, and on present situation in Korea. ′Automotive vehicle exhaust′ problem was perceived to be the most severe environmental problems among specific 30 items. ′Industrial source air pollution′,′toxic air pollutants′, and ′domestic and industrial source pollutants to surface water′ were relatively severe environmental problems comparing to other problems. The pollution issues were classified into four categories by two aspects of perception; risk in general setting and seriousness in Korea situation. If the issues were highly serious in Korea and low risk perception in general setting then it is named "the Korea-specific group". Those that were all high score in two aspects, named "the Common group". Those that were all low in two aspects, named "the Nonsignificant group". And the issues were high risk perception in general setting and low seriousness in Korean situation, named "the Latent group".
